




Looking UP is the inspiring story of Eitan Armon, a young man facing encroaching blindness who takes on the challenge of climbing the world’s most epic granite wall. While in military service at age 20, Eitan is diagnosed with Retinitis Pigmentosa, a rare and incurable genetic disease that causes blindness. With only 5% of his central vision remaining, Eitan learns to rock climb and ascends Yosemite’s daunting El Capitan. Looking Up documents Eitan’s journey and resilience, demonstrating the endless possibilities for those who approach life with positivity.

EITAN ARMON
Eitan is a veteran IDF paratrooper, where he was a sharpshooter and named the outstanding soldier of his company. After getting diagnosed with RP, Eitan was medically discharged from the military and enrolled at Columbia University, where he studied neuropsychology. Eitan was a Phi Beta Kappa honors graduate and a Rhodes Scholar finalist. Since graduating, Eitan has been applying the lessons he learned through his own patient experience and positive psychology research by working to raise awareness for RP and emerging treatments. Eitan serves as a mentor to others with visual impairments and as a member of the Foundation for Fighting Blindness Strategic Council. Professionally, Eitan works as a financial analyst covering healthcare services companies.
In his spare time, Eitan is an avid skier and hiker, rabid Boston sports fan, and loves dancing with his friends and family.

ELENA NEUMAN
Producer/Director
Elena is an award-winning documentary filmmaker and founder of NeumanFILMS based in New York City. Elena’s short film about four Holocaust survivors, People Forget, New Haven Remembers, aired on Connecticut Public Television and is currently streaming on CPTV. Elena co-produced/directed Wishmakers, a short film about an award-winning wine produced by mentally handicapped adults. The film won the International Gold Medal from the World Humanitarian Awards and an award of merit at IndieFEST. Elena has also produced content for many educational and non-profit organizations. Looking UP marks Elena’s feature film directorial debut for which she was awarded the NY Women in Film and Television Award for Excellence in Documentary Directing. The film also won the jury award for Best Documentary Feature at the Lonely Seal Film Festival.
Previously, Elena was an associate producer at Manifold Productions where she worked on three PBS films: The Fall of Newt Gingrich, Rediscovering George Washington, and God and the Inner City. A graduate of Cornell and Yale Universities, Elena spent her early career as a print journalist before segueing into documentary filmmaking. When she's not making films, Elena loves hiking, biking and skiing in the mountains. Filming in Yosemite was a dream come true.
